N-Methyl (+-)-13-alpha-hydroxyxylopinine iodide (beta)

TL;DR: N-Methyl (+-)-13-alpha-hydroxyxylopinine iodide (beta) (CAS 120021-25-2) is a chemical compound with molecular formula C22H28INO5 and molecular weight 513.1012 g/mol, supplied by CoreyChem (Career Henan Chemical Co., Ltd.) with ISO-certified quality and global shipping.

(13S,13aR)-2,3,10,11-tetramethoxy-7-methyl-6,8,13,13a-tetrahydro-5H-isoquinolino[2,1-b]isoquinolin-7-ium-13-ol iodide

Also Known As: N-Methyl (+-)-13-alpha-hydroxyxylopinine iodide (beta), 6H-Dibenzo(a,g)quinolizinium, 5,8,13,13a-tetrahydro-13-hydroxy-7-methyl-2,3,10,11-tetramethoxy-, iodide, (7-alpha,13-alpha,13a-beta)-(+-)-, (13S,13aR)-2,3,10,11-tetramethoxy-7-methyl-6,8,13,13a-tetrahydro-5H-isoquinolino[2,1-b]isoquinolin-7-ium-13-ol iodide

CAS Number
120021-25-2
Molecular Formula
C22H28INO5
Molecular Weight
513.1012 g/mol

Technical Specifications

Molecular FormulaC22H28INO5
Molecular Weight513.1012 g/mol
XLogP0.016
Topological Polar Surface Area (TPSA)57.2 Ų
Hydrogen Bond Donors1
Hydrogen Bond Acceptors6
Rotatable Bonds4
Exact Mass513.1012 Da
Heavy Atoms29
Complexity547.0
SMILESC[N+]12CCC3=CC(=C(C=C3[C@@H]1[C@H](C4=CC(=C(C=C4C2)OC)OC)O)OC)OC.[I-]
InChIKeyANXDBALJIGZCGD-UYLWVFEMSA-M
